Fuzzy model reference learning (FMRL) control applied to a boiler steam drum

The use of fuzzy logic controllers (FLCs) has seen a surge in many applications. Although these are simple to synthesis once the fuzzy rules are known; it takes experience to produce these rules and takes a fair amount of time to tune them. For this reason, a fuzzy system that can learn these rules has significant advantage over one that doesn`t. In this paper, the authors examine one such method for constructing the fuzzy rules. The method is then applied to the problem of boiler steam drum control to demonstrate its feasibility.
